浅析SVN常见问题及解决方法
深入SVN常见图标及应对之策
在协同工作中,SVN的版本控制扮演着至关重要的角色。但使用SVN时,你可能会遇到各种图标提示,这些图标代表不同的状态和问题。接下来,我们将逐一这些图标,并为你提供应对策略。
1. 黄色感叹号(存在冲突):
当多人同时对同一文件进行修改时,冲突就产生了。仿佛是一场“修改争夺战”,你的提交可能会被别人的提交覆盖。你需要仔细审查冲突内容。
如果你认为自己的修改无效,可以通过TSVN还原你的修改。
若你认为自己的修改有价值,而别人的提交可视为无效,可以标记为“解决冲突”后提交。
若双方修改都有价值,则需要手动合并,再标注为“解决冲突”后提交。寻找带有黄色感叹号的文件,它们是冲突的“战场”,需要你根据实际情况处理。
2. 米字号(本地存在未提交修改):
这个图标提醒你,有尚未提交的本地代码。这些代码可能是你辛苦工作的成果,不要忘了及时提交,确保团队其他成员也能受益。
3. 问号(新加入的资源):
当项目中新增文件、图片、代码等资源时,会出现此图标。它是项目的“新鲜血液”,带来新的功能和体验。
4. 红色感叹号(本地与库代码不一致):
当本地代码与SVN库中的代码存在差异时,会出现此提示。为了保持代码的一致性,建议删除带红色感叹号的文件,然后进行更新。
5. 灰色向右箭头(本地有未提交修改):
这意味着你有本地修改但尚未上库。不要忘了将这些宝贵的改动提交到SVN,以便团队共享。
6. 蓝色向左箭头(SVN上有更新):
当SVN上有新的代码更新时,这个箭头会提醒你。在修改前,务必先更新代码,确保你的工作是在的代码基础上进行的。
7. 灰色/蓝色箭头带加号(本地/SVN新增文件):
无论是本地还是SVN新增的文件,都需要关注并保持一致。修改完成后,及时提交到SVN。
8. 灰色/蓝色箭头带减号(本地/SVN删除文件):
当文件在本地或SVN上被删除时,需要确认是否真的需要删除。确认后,记得更新到SVN库,保持版本的一致性。
9. 红色双向箭头(本地与SVN都修改过的文件):
当本地和SVN上都有修改时,可能存在冲突。建议先更新代码,再合并改动。信任是成功的关键,不仅要自己相信自己,还要赢得团队和周围朋友的信任。
作为开发者,了解这些图标背后的含义并知道如何应对是日常工作的必备技能。希望这篇文章能帮助你更好地使用SVN,与团队协同工作,共同推进项目的进展。
编程语言
- 浅析SVN常见问题及解决方法
- 详解webpack之图片引入-增强的file-loader:url-loade
- vue mixins组件复用的几种方式(小结)
- PHP图片等比例缩放生成缩略图函数分享
- PHP实现无限极分类图文教程
- 使用AjaxPro.Net框架实现在客户端调用服务端的方法
- 详解vue-router 命名路由和命名视图
- 解决php写入数据库乱码的问题
- 如何制作一个安全的页面?
- java中String类型变量的赋值问题介绍
- JS中dom0级事件和dom2级事件的区别介绍
- ASP.NET MVC中设置跨域访问问题
- 原生JavaScript编写俄罗斯方块
- jQuery实现将div中滚动条滚动到指定位置的方法
- SQL查询中in和exists的区别分析
- 微信小程序本作用域下调用全局JS详解及实例